This is the first version to use Icinga DB as an event source for Icinga
Notifications. If configured accordingly, Icinga DB forwards events
crafted from the Redis pipeline to the Icinga Notifications API.
This required a small refactoring of the history synchronization to
allow hooking into the Redis stream. Afterwards, the newly introduced
notifications package handles the rest.
Note: As part of this architectural change, Icinga Notifications offers
filters to be evaluated by Icinga DB. At the moment, these are SQL
queries being executed on the Icinga DB relational database. Either
consider both Icinga DB and Icinga Notifications to be part of the same
trust domain or consider the security implications.
Furthermore, this change requires a change on Icinga Notifications as
well. This will not work with the current version 0.1.1.
As reported in #726, the default values for `database.options` are
overwritten by go-yaml. By commenting out the key of the
empty/unmodified YAML dictionary, this bug is mitigated. To make this
change consistent, the keys of all other unmodified dictionary blocks
have also been commented out.
